Why UFO High Bays Dominate Industrial Architecture

Traditional metal halide and high-pressure sodium luminaires are rapidly phasing out due to high maintenance cycles, high power consumption, and long strike times. Modern LED UFO High Bays deliver instantaneous illumination, superior thermal management, and compact form factors modeled after natural heat dissipation physics.

For B2B procurement leads, sourcing from Tier-1 Chinese manufacturers isn't just about reducing unit cost. It is an optimization strategy to achieve lower Total Cost of Ownership (TCO) through engineering excellence, compliant driver configurations, and optical refraction design that ensures warehouse floors receive maximum foot-candles per watt.

  • Up to 75% energy reduction compared to legacy HID/HPS fixtures.
  • Advanced optical distribution patterns (60°, 90°, 120°) minimize light waste.
  • Integrated smart nodes (0-10V, DALI, ZigBee) ready for next-gen automation.
  • Extended L70 lifespans surpassing 100,000 operational hours.

Thermal Dynamics & Material Science

Heat is the primary enemy of LED chips and driver capacitors. Our housings utilize die-cast ADC12 aluminum with high thermal conductivity. The integrated convective flow design speeds heat dispersion, keeping the junction temperature below 80°C to guarantee minimal luminous decay over a 10-year span.

Heat Sink Material Die-Cast ADC12 Pure Aluminum
Thermal Conductivity 96 W/m·K
Driver Options Sosen, MeanWell, Inventronics (Isolated)
LED Component Lumileds 2835 / Osram Duris / Nichia

Optical Distribution & Intelligent Control

Using high-transmittance polycarbonate (PC) lenses and multi-angle optical systems, our lamps reduce glare while focusing light precisely on work surfaces. We support smart dimming interfaces to allow integration with ambient light sensors and motion detectors.

Optical Angles 60° | 90° | 120° (Standard Clear / Frosted)
Color Rendering Index Ra > 80 (Optional Ra > 90 for Inspection zones)
Dimming Protocol 0-10V, PWM, DALI-2, Zigbee/Casambi compatible
Surge Protection 6kV Line-to-Line, 10kV Line-to-Earth

Rigorous Testing Equipment

  • Integrating Sphere: Measures total luminous flux, color temperature, and color rendering metrics.
  • Goniophotometer: Evaluates spatial luminous intensity distribution curves for accurate IES photometric data.
  • Environmental Chambers: Simulates extreme thermal cycling from -40°C to +85°C to test driver and chip endurance.
  • IPX6 Water Spray Booth: Tests integrity against high-pressure water ingress under structural loads.
